Spot Typical iPhone Problems: What You Need to Know First

When people face difficulties with their iPhones, understanding the most common problems can greatly streamline the repair process. Frequent problems consist of screen damage, battery degradation, and software malfunctions. Screen cracks are commonly caused by accidental drops, placing them among the most frequently required repairs. Battery issues commonly present as fast power loss or an inability to maintain a charge, especially in older devices. Software malfunctions may result in unresponsive apps or repeated crashes, frequently fixed through a basic restart or software update.

Another common issue relates to connectivity challenges, affecting Wi-Fi and Bluetooth functionalities, which can stem from software settings or hardware failures. Users can also come across sound-related issues, such as distorted audio or malfunctioning speakers, commonly associated with hardware issues or software errors. Identifying these typical problems allows users to make well-informed repair decisions, assisting them in saving both time and money during repairs.

Self-Help iPhone Repair Tips for Small Issues

Many iPhone users experience minor issues that can be easily addressed without the help of a professional. For instance, a cracked screen can often be addressed with a do-it-yourself repair kit, which typically includes bonding material and a new glass panel. Users ought to consult online tutorials to guarantee correct installation.

Another common issue is a sluggish device. Wiping the cache and eliminating unnecessary apps can greatly enhance speed. Performing a device restart can additionally fix minor glitches.

Battery troubles, including excessive battery depletion, might be addressed by changing preferences for example display brightness and app refresh settings. Owners may also perform a battery replacement independently with the help of online instructions, as long as they possess the necessary tools.

Additionally, if the iPhone is experiencing charging issues, looking at the charging port for dirt and gently clearing it with a toothpick can commonly fix the problem. By implementing these practical tips, iPhone owners can cut costs and prolong the lifespan of their devices without seeking professional help.

An Overview of Warranty Coverage

Warranty protection commonly includes fixes for manufacturing defects but fails to cover damage from accidents. Apple's default warranty period spans one year, with the ability to extend coverage via AppleCare+ at an extra cost. This additional plan offers protection against accidental damage, however with a service fee for each claim. Users should assess their usage patterns and risk factors when deciding on warranty options. For users who regularly upgrade or handle their devices carefully, the default coverage may be adequate. Conversely, heavy users or those prone to accidents may consider expanded protection a valuable choice, offering reassurance and possible cost savings on repairs.

Avoid Repair Scams: Key Warning Signs to Know

What warning signs suggest a possible repair scam when looking for iPhone services? For starters, extremely low prices may be cause for concern; if a repair service offers deals that seem too good to be true, it likely compromises quality. Moreover, a failure to provide clear information about the repair procedure and parts involved could point to dishonesty. Trustworthy service providers ought to offer thorough estimates and clarify the repair process.

Another warning sign is high-pressure sales tactics, including pressuring clients to decide rapidly without adequate time to evaluate options. Client feedback can also provide valuable information; consistently negative feedback or lack of reviews should prompt caution.

Additionally, credible repair services usually maintain a physical location and a professional web presence. If a business operates solely online without a proper address or way to reach them, it might not be legitimate. Staying alert to these indicators can assist customers in avoiding deceptive practices and ensure a trustworthy repair experience.

Avoiding Future Damage: Strategies to Safeguard Your iPhone

Protecting your iPhone from damage demands preventive steps. iPhone users should invest in a premium screen protector and case to cushion impacts and avoid screen damage. Regularly cleaning the device, especially the ports, can preserve device performance and reduce dust accumulation.

Moreover, preventing contact with harsh temperatures and moisture is essential; owners should avoid leaving their phones in hot cars or near water sources. Applying software updates promptly confirms that the device functions optimally and takes advantage of the most recent security enhancements.

Building a routine for safe storage is just as vital; iPhone users should put their iPhones in safe pockets or bags when on the go. Furthermore, practicing mindful usage, such as steering clear of multitasking while operating the device, can also decrease the chance of mishaps. By following these preventive measures, iPhone owners can considerably increase the life expectancy of their phones and prevent expensive repairs.

What Supplies Do I Need for DIY iPhone Repairs?

For those attempting DIY iPhone repairs, must-have tools consist of a set of precision screwdrivers, plastic pry tools, precision tweezers, suction cups, and a heat gun. Such tools support careful disassembly and reassembly of the device during repairs.
